Late Sunday night I’m sipping tea
and watching the end
of, “Ray Donovan: The Movie.”
And crying.
Chauncey, the puppy, should be
running in dreams after
hounding Mlady and Dotty
all day; instead, he’s nibbling
my toes.
What a silly, synchronous
act of comforting.
